Output edca15b993c108c8644b9db32eb4324a2f64d036cecbcc034b5781150f8207e9:10

value
34543801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 322aa7b7ae1761063991e537a8f7294e7b9ff999 OP_EQUAL
address
MCUR7keAhEnD37UuCpN4PvhSXkvJC4oiER
transaction
edca15b993c108c8644b9db32eb4324a2f64d036cecbcc034b5781150f8207e9
spent
true